MANILA, Philippines – The hospitality arm of DoubleDragon Corp. is expanding deeper into Southeast Asia after securing agreements for the development of a new Hotel101 property in Bangkok, Thailand, marking another milestone in its overseas expansion.
In a disclosure on Wednesday, DoubleDragon said its Nasdaq-listed subsidiary, Hotel101 Global Holdings Corp., signed definitive binding agreements with Thai developer Origin Property PCL for the joint venture development of Hotel101-Bangkok.

The project will rise on an 8,336-square-meter site along Phahon Yothin Road near Don Mueang International Airport and right beside the Yaek Kor Por Aor BTS Station.
